THE Treloar School and trust site at Upper Froyle, near Alton, has been sold for around £12m.
The site was vacated at the beginning of the year when the school and trust relocated to new state-of-the-art buildings on the college site in Holybourne.
Undertaken on behalf of the trust by estate agents Savills, the sale of the 17-and-a-half acre freehold site, embracing the former school campus and neighbouring Froyle House, will support further phases of development at Holybourne as part of Treloar's Vision – to provide the highest quality facilities for students with severe and complex disabilities.
